Transparent Conductive Coatings for Glass Applications

Wiki Article

Transparent conductive coatings offer a unique combination of electrical conductivity and optical transparency, making them ideal for diverse glass applications. These coatings are typically manufactured from materials like indium tin oxide (ITO) or substitutes based on carbon nanotubes or graphene. Applications range from touch screens and displays to photovoltaic cells and sensors. The need for transparent conductive coatings continues to expand as the need for flexible electronics and smart glass elements becomes increasingly prevalent.

Exploring the Cost Landscape of Conductive Glass

Conductive glass has emerged as a key component in various applications, ranging from touchscreens to energy harvesting devices. The necessity of this versatile material has influenced a dynamic price landscape, with factors such as production expenses, raw materials availability, and market dynamics all playing a role. Analyzing these impacts is crucial for both producers and end-users to navigate the existing price environment.

A range of factors can affect the cost of conductive glass.

* Manufacturing processes, which can be labor-intensive, contribute to the overall cost.

* The procurement and cost of raw materials, such as fluorine-doped tin oxide, are also significant considerations.

Furthermore, market demand can change depending on the implementation of conductive glass in specific industries. For example, increasing demand from the electronics industry can result in price rises.
